A licensed casino is the foundation of a safe gambling experience. Look for licences from reputable regulators such as the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ission or the Philippines (Cagayan). These bodies enforce strict audits on RTP (return‑to‑player) and fairness.
Security should be obvious: SSL encryption, two‑factor authentication for e‑wallet log‑ins, and clear privacy policies. A quick Google search for player reviews can also reveal if the casino has a history of delayed payouts or poor support.

Prompt, knowledgeable support can save you from a frustrating withdrawal or a technical glitch. Look for 24/7 live chat, a toll‑free phone number and a thorough FAQ section. Good casinos also provide responsible gambling tools – deposit limits, self‑exclusion options and links to local helplines.
Never ignore red flags such as vague response times, missing licence numbers, or pressure to gamble more to meet wagering requirements.
